Could Online Therapy Be a Good Fit?
Many people wonder whether remote therapy can make a meaningful difference. For a range of common concerns - including stress, anxiety, depression, relationship challenges, and life transitions - online therapy can be a suitable and effective option that aligns with many people’s needs.One major advantage is flexibility. Clients can connect with therapists through video calls, phone sessions, live chat, or in-app messaging, which makes it easier to fit care into a busy schedule or manage therapy from different locations.
Licensed professionals provide the therapeutic support, and clients may switch therapists at any time if a different fit is desired. For many, online therapy offers a practical, accessible path to working through challenging issues and building coping skills.
